Stores

Storage containers are extremely versatile, offering an enduring and secure place to store your belongings. They are also very economical since they don't need ongoing rental costs and they come with full ownership. With their heavy-duty locks and corrugated steel construction, they provide a high level of security.

Shipping container dimensions are usually based on exterior measurements, which means internal space is often restricted. However, this is able to be overcome with strategic planning and organisation. Installing shelving systems along walls maximizes vertical space which keeps things off the floor and accessible. Partition walls can be used to divide the space into various areas, while providing a clear path through.

Shelving units are also useful if you're storing long items, such as fabrics or pipes. Pipe racks are metal arms that extend from the wall, allowing you to stack items on them instead of on shelves where they could fall off. They are ideal to store tools since they are easy to reach without the need to move anything else.

A container can be used to create an individual library of books with shelves that extend from the floor to the ceiling, which are secured with brackets. The inclusion of shelves in the container helps to keep books upright, which reduces wear and tear on spines. Labels can also be a huge help. A simple labelling machine, or even sticky labels can be used to label the contents.

Residential

Shipping containers are becoming more popular as building materials for homes, cabins, and studios. Although the trend might seem to be a fad, there are a lot of benefits for living in a container home. For example, these structures are more affordable to build and have more value for resales than traditional houses. Moreover, they are easy to transport. They are an ideal choice for those who prefer to move around or need to move for work.

There are a few important things to consider before moving into a 30ft shipping container container home. The first step is to find a suitable location for your home. Certain towns and cities have strict regulations regarding alternative dwellings, while others are more lenient. When you are considering purchasing land for a container-home, it is important to check out the building codes and zoning laws in your local area.

Containers are made of steel, which is vulnerable to corrosion. The walls of the shipping container are thin, and don't provide much insulation. It can be difficult to regulate humidity and temperature in cold or hot climates.

There are a variety of companies that specialize in building homes out of shipping containers. They can design the exterior and interior of your container house to meet your specific needs. They can also offer additional features, including solar panels and an water treatment system.

Additionally, these companies can help you obtain the mortgage you require if you need it. To ensure the success of your project, it is recommended that you consult with an experienced contractor. Shipping container homes are not for the novice. They require a lot of knowledge. With the right planning and the right resources, you can build a beautiful and unique home out of the metal containers.

High Cube

When it comes to shipping containers, the standard options are ideal for storage and cargo, but if you require more height, a high cube option is the best option. These containers provide more headroom of a foot however they still keep the standard width and length dimensions.

Containers can be moved more easily when they be able to fit within the standard height clearances. They are also great for modifications like office or housing space where an extra foot of headroom can be crucial.

The extra height lets you to store higher-height equipment without having to lay it flat. They are also able to handle more weight than traditional containers, making them a better option for larger items or items that require some extra space on the upper area.

High cube containers have some disadvantages, despite the many advantages. They are more expensive to transport and are more expensive than standard containers. The additional height makes it difficult to stack and maneuver, which can be a problem for some projects and sites. When deciding whether a high-cube container is right for you, it's essential to consider your site and transport requirements.
